ABS DTC Troubleshooting: 12-11, 14-11, 16-11, 18-11
DTC 12-11: Right-front Wheel Speed Sensor Electrical Noise or Intermittent Interruption
DTC 14-11: Left-front Wheel Speed Sensor Electrical Noise or Intermittent Interruption
DTC 16-11: Right-rear Wheel Speed Sensor Electrical Noise or Intermittent Interruption
DTC 18-11: Left-rear Wheel Speed Sensor Electrical Noise or Intermittent Interruption
NOTE: These DTCs may be caused by electrical interference. Check for aftermarket devices installed in the vehicle when these DTCs are indicated.
1. Turn the ignition switch to ON (II).
2. Clear the DTC with the HDS.
3. Test-drive the vehicle.
NOTE: Drive the vehicle on the road, not on a lift.
4. Check for DTCs with the HDS.
Is DTC 12-11, 14-11, 16-11, and/or 18-11 indicated?
YES - If DTC 12-12, 14-12, 16-12, or 18-12 is indicated at the same time, do the DTC 12-12, 14-12, 16-12, or 18-12 troubleshooting first. ABS (Without VSA) If DTC 12-12, 14-12, 16-12, or 18-12 is not indicated, go to step 5.
NO - If any other DTCs are indicated, go to the indicated DTCs troubleshooting. If DTCs are not indicated, there is an intermittent failure, the system is OK at this time. Check for loose terminals between the wheel speed sensor 2P connector and the ABS modulator-control unit 25P connector. Refer to intermittent failures troubleshooting. 5. Turn the ignition switch to LOCK (0).
6. Check that the appropriate wheel speed sensor is properly mounted. ABS Wheel Speed Sensor Replacement (Without VSA)
Is the wheel speed sensor installation OK?
YES - Check for loose terminals in the ABS modulator-control unit 25P connector. If necessary, substitute a known-good ABS modulator-control unit: Except Si model, Service and Repair Si model, Service and Repair and retest.
NO - Reinstall the wheel speed sensor, and check the mounting position. ABS Wheel Speed Sensor Replacement (Without VSA)
